Learning to play the piano is a fulfilling and rewarding experience at any age While many people may think that piano lessons are only for children, more and more adults are discovering the joy and benefits of learning to play the piano Whether you have never touched a piano before or used to play as a child and want to pick it back up, there are numerous reasons why taking piano lessons as an adult can be a great decision.

One of the primary benefits of taking piano lessons as an adult is the cognitive advantages it offers Learning to play the piano involves a variety of cognitive skills, including hand-eye coordination, memory, concentration, and multitasking Studies have shown that playing an instrument like the piano can improve brain function and mental acuity in adults, which can have long-term benefits for overall brain health and cognitive function.

In addition to the cognitive benefits, learning to play the piano can also be a great stress reliever for adults Playing the piano requires focus and concentration, which can help take your mind off of any worries or stresses in your life Music has the power to evoke emotions and provide an outlet for self-expression, making it a therapeutic and relaxing activity for adults looking to unwind after a long day.

Taking piano lessons as an adult can also help improve your hand strength and dexterity Playing the piano involves using both hands independently, which can help strengthen the muscles in your fingers and hands This can be especially beneficial for older adults looking to improve their manual dexterity and prevent conditions like arthritis or carpal tunnel syndrome.
